The Court of Accounts has published the second part of its annual report on local government finances. In the first pamphlet, published last July, the Court noted that while 2022 had been a very favourable year, 2023 saw a general deterioration in the financial position of local authorities. Created in France in 1791, inheritance tax imposes a charge on the net inheritance received by each heir, depending on their relationship to the deceased. Between 2017 and 2023, 271 international organisations and multilateral funds received French public funding. Established in 1964, the National Forest Office (Office National des Forêts, ONF) is an industrial and commercial public agency (EPIC) responsible for the sustainable management of public forests.
